Veritas is seeking a Middle School Girls Volleyball coach for the fall season of 2026.
This coach will be responsible for assisting the head coach and leading middle school girls in their spiritual and physical development through the Veritas Volleyball program.
Applicants must have general knowledge of volleyball and prior experience in playing.
Prior coaching experience is preferred, but not required.
